South Oxfordshire’s average house price stood at £466,091 in April 2026, according to the UK House Price Index. That is down 1.3% from March, when the average was £472,052.
It is still above the level seen a year earlier, with annual growth of 1.7%. The latest figure shows a modest fall after a stronger March.
Private rents in South Oxfordshire stood at an average of £1,381 in May 2026, according to the ONS Price Index of Private Rents. That is almost unchanged from April, when the average was £1,380.
The monthly move was a very small rise of 0.07%. The annual picture is weaker.
South Oxfordshire has a comparatively strong labour-market profile in the latest ONS and Nomis data. The resident population was 156,470 in 2024, giving useful context for a district with a sizeable working-age base and a broad local labour pool.
